Flemming Funch discusses how the Internet may in the future enhance synchronicity. The technology for what he proposes exists today it just hasn’t been applied to this space. One could potentially see tremendous benefits if this were implemented within social networks, but the potential abuse by unscrupulous marketers and overly invasive governments is high, as well.
